btw - if you try other ilf limbs than Morrison, don't force them in and check to see that the butt end of the limb is not force against the end of the riser pocket. I gotta try before you buy. since the morrison is a key hole attachment, they have to be cut for a specific ilf fitting. not all ilf fittings are the same by a long shot.
